repulse

Definitions

To drive back an attack or an attacker.

To cause someone to feel intense distaste or aversion.

To reject or refuse someone or something in an unfriendly manner.

Examples

The smell of the rotting garbage was enough to repulse anyone who walked past the alley.

The army was able to repulse the enemy attack and hold their position on the ridge.

His arrogant attitude and constant bragging tend to repulse potential friends.

Synonyms

repel disgust revolt nauseate offend deter reject

Antonyms

attract entice allure delight please welcome invite
